متن کاملTechniques for high-quality ACELP coding of wideband speech
We present in this paper new methods for achieving highquality wideband speech at low rates using the ACELP algorithm. Several innovations are introduced to optimize the quality and minimize the complexity of the coder. متن کاملHigh quality coding of wideband speech at 24 kbit/s
This paper proposes a Wideband-CELP-Coding scheme (bandwidth 7kHz) at 24 kbit/s. The codec introduces a delay of just 10 ms. This fulfills the requirements of a possible codec candidate for wideband speech coding within DECT or video applications [I]. متن کاملNatural quality variable-rate spectral speech coding below 3.0 kbps
We propose new techniques for natural quality variable rate spectral speech coding at an average rate of 2.2 kbps for dialog speech and 2.8 kbps for monolog speech. The coder models the Fourier spectrum of each frame and it builds on recent enhancements to the classical multiband excitation (MBE) approach.
